Custom C

The Custom C tractor is a versatile machine built for farm work. It has a gear transmission with 4 forward gears and 1 reverse gear, giving farmers good control over their speed. The tractor is powered by a Chrysler IND 5 engine, which runs on gasoline and has 6 cylinders. This liquid-cooled engine can produce 52 horsepower at 1800 RPM, making it strong enough for many farm tasks. The Custom C is a mid-sized tractor, measuring 128 inches long and 68 inches tall. It weighs 3450 pounds, which helps it stay stable during work. The engine has a displacement of 217.8 cubic inches, with a bore of 3.25 inches and a stroke of 4.375 inches. One notable feature is its torque, which reaches 141 lb-ft at 1200 RPM, giving the tractor good pulling power at lower speeds. This tractor is designed to be a reliable and efficient helper for farmers who need a straightforward, capable machine for their daily tasks.
